Output d307f0d2e45ddac2bad367d400c6e319d4d883b701e63f86d23d2b32060319cc:85

value
71368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d20937bbf39885a6978622ed4157fa3994f93b9 OP_EQUAL
address
3MrEHNB3HSubR4XWgYFbuao417MEN9vVUE
transaction
d307f0d2e45ddac2bad367d400c6e319d4d883b701e63f86d23d2b32060319cc